Job Description
We’re looking for an experienced editor with a passion for romance! The editor will be responsible for managing a number of authors and editing manuscripts for the four UK acquired Harlequin/Mills & Boon series (Medical, Harlequin Romance/M&BTrue Love, Harlequin Presents/M&B Modern and Historical).
The Editor will report to the Senior Editor of Harlequin Medical and Harlequin Romance. The successful candidate will be responsible for managing 20-30 authors and editing their manuscripts (40-50 manuscripts a year) for the four UK acquired series, with a particular focus on acquiring and developing new authors, outreach to under-represented authors as well as supporting the packaging strategies of the Medical and Romance series.
Key Accountabilities:
Provide strong creative support to the Harlequin Medical and Romance team, working on creative packaging elements such as back cover copy and titles for the series, and contributing to in-house development of linked editorial projects.
Develop and implement the company’s acquisition and build strategies and contribute innovative ideas in this process, including outreach to under-represented writers and writers’ organisations.
Proactively recognize needs, opportunities and trends that will benefit the Harlequin Medical and Romance imprints
Regular liaison with the production department, art department, marketing department, public relations; Direct-To-Consumer; Digital in both UK and North America.
Represent the program/company at both internal and external conferences and on social media
Manage an author base across all UK-acquired series and elicit the highest quality of writing
Perform editorial work on manuscripts including reading and evaluating proposals, providing revision suggestions to authors; line editing; preparation of ancillary book matter including back cover copy
Ensure the ongoing and timely supply of high quality, saleable titles
Requirements:
Demonstrable experience of author management, editing commercial fiction and finding and developing new authors.
Strong editorial skills, from manuscript revision to line editing to copy writing.
Strong communication, organization and editorial skills, including project management, planning and organising, teamwork and collaboration, negotiation skills and a drive for results.
A solid understanding of the print and digital markets, particularly in the UK and North America.
A high level of creativity/innovation, functional/technical knowledge, ability to take initiative.
Strong social media skills.
A passion for romance fiction.
